Three axioms have evolved for developing effective human-computer interactions: (1) Users must be an early and continuous focus during interface design; (2) the design process should be iterative, allowing for evaluation and correction of identified problems; and (3) formal evaluation should take place using rigorous experimental or qualitative methods.


Definitions:

Framing Change

Refers to the process of strategically shaping the way change is presented or communicated to ensure it is perceived positively or accepted by stakeholders.

Transformational Change

Significant, radical change that fundamentally alters the culture, core values, and operations of an organization.

Coercive Change

A strategy of implementing change through the use of pressures or threats, often resulting in resistance from those affected.

Radical Change

Transformative, significant alterations to the structure, strategies, or operations of an organization that fundamentally redefine its nature.
